385/65R22.5宽基全钢载重子午线轮胎 |
Optimization on the Belt Structure of 385/65R22.5 Wide Base Truck and Bus Radial Tire |

中文摘要: |
介绍385/65R22.5宽基全钢载重子午线轮胎带束层结构优化设计。基于我公司轮胎外轮廓设计,带束层由4层结构改为3层带束层加2层0°带束层结构。改进后轮胎接地印痕更合理,接地面积增大5%,接地压力分布更均匀且平均压力更小,使成品轮胎耐久性试验时间延长25%。 |
英文摘要: |
The design on the belt structure of 385/65R22.5 wide base truck and bus radial tire was optimized.The design was based on original tire outer profile,but the 4-layer belt structure was changed into 3 layers of belt and additional 2 layers of 0° belt.After the modification,the tire footprint was adjusted,the ground contact area increased 5%,the ground contact pressure distribution was more uniform and the average contact pressure was reduced,which could extend the endurance time of finished tire by 25%. |
